Constructing a Rhombus with a Given Base

Construction Algorithm
1 Construct a line AB as a given base of the rhombus.
2 Construct the line BC so that AB = BC.
3 Construct the diagonal AC.
4 Construct a perpendicular line to AC through the point B.
5 Construct a circle centered at C and has radius AB.
6 Generate the intersection point between the constructed circle at C and the perpendicular line through B to get the fourth point of the rhombus D.
7 Join up the four points A, B, C, and D to get the required rhombus.

Construction Theorems

A rhombus is a parallelogram in which two adjacent sides are equal in length.

The two diagonals of a rhombus are perpendicular to each other.
